Southern Tasmania Forecast (issued Friday 27th December)

Best Days: Sunday morning, Monday, Tuesday, Wednesday

Recap

Wednesday's swell backed off into yesterday with calm winds at dawn ahead of a shallow change.

Today a new W/SW swell has filled in offering inconsistent 1-2ft waves with a light offshore wind. A fresh S/SE change has since moved through creating poor conditions.

This weekend onwards (Dec 28 onwards)

Today's swell will fade into tomorrow leaving tiny waves across the coast, but come Sunday a strong new W/SW groundswell should fill in.

This is related to a cold front drifting in from the west deepening and forming a low pressure centre right off our door step, generating a fetch of gale to severe-gale W/SW winds in our swell window (pictured right).

This should kick up a solid 3ft+ of W/SW swell Sunday, peaking later in the day and then easing from 3-4ft Monday morning out of the SW.

Winds on Sunday will be fresh from the W tending W/SW, with Monday seeing great W/NW winds all day.

The swell should ease slowly Tuesday as the low starts to weaken and heads off to the east.

The rest of the week will consistent of smaller levels of W/SW swell, probably not topping 1-2ft.
